I honestly don't know if this could help but, I'll speak from my similar experience with Django. I had to do for a client a dynamic map in real time so that users can select their seats for a specific event. In the first MVP tickets sold in less then 10 minutes, over 400 users at the same time online trying to buy the seats. (I mention this to get in the context of why I used it).

We achieved this with Django, Socket.IO, PostgreSQL and for the frontend React. With the power of Socket IO we manage to achieve a real time connection with the database with a reaaally low response time.

The drawbacks of Django are that everyone knows that Django is not really good for real-time activities but in combination with Socket.IO this can be achieve really good.

Automations are what makes a CRM powerful. With Celery and RabbitMQ we've been able to make powerful automations that truly works for our clients. Such as for example, automatic daily reports, reminders for their activities, important notifications regarding their client activities and actions on the website and more.

We use Celery basically for everything that needs to be scheduled for the future, and using RabbitMQ as our Queue-broker is amazing since it fully integrates with Django and Celery storing on our database results of the tasks done so we can see if anything fails immediately.

We recently implemented GraphQL because we needed to build dynamic reports based on the user preference and configuration, this was extremely complicated with our actual RESTful API, the code started to get harder to maintain but switching to GraphQL helped us to to build beautiful reports for our clients that truly help them make data-driven decisions.

Our goal is to implemented GraphQL in the whole platform eventually, we are using Graphene , a python library for Django .

We use ExpressJS because we need to dynamically render routes depending on the client website configuration, say for example you have 10 websites on an app but all those websites have different pages (sitemaps), in order to map it with next we had to ship a custom express server that handle the routes and then pass it to next so it can dynamically render the website requesting the user based on the domain.

We use Mixpanel because it's the best way to keep track of all the actions users do on our website. AlterEstate is a software for real estate companies, that means, that the search people do on the websites === money $ because this data can give a company the possibility to take action with actual and real data of whats happening on their website.

We use MixPanel basically in everything and anything. We track all the events users do on our website and on our platform in order to see whats wrong UX-speaking, and what could improve in the platform. We also provide our clients with insights based on the data collected with mixpanel.
